CIMB: Protocol signed with Luso-Mexican Chamber of Commerce and Industry.


The Noble Hall of the Baixo Alentejo Intermunicipal Community hosted the signing ceremony of the Collaboration Protocol between CIMBAL, represented by the President of the Intermunicipal Council, Antonio Boot, and the Luso-Mexican Chamber of Commerce and Industry, represented by the President of the Board, Eduardo Serra Jorge, and Treasurer, John Philip Jesus.

The main objective of the Protocol is to encourage the internationalization of companies in Baixo Alentejo, mainly through a support project approved under the Compete Program, with training actions aimed at promoting knowledge about access to the Mexican market and promotional actions.

The Protocol had the High Patronage of the Ambassador of the United Mexican States to the Portuguese Republic, Dr. Bruno Figueroa, who was represented at the ceremony by the Minister Counselor, Ursula Dozal and the person in charge of Economic Affairs, Commercial and Tourist Promotion, Laura Garzon.

At the project presentation meeting, A group of business and farmer associations were present, as well as other public and private entities.

Promotional sessions will soon be scheduled for companies in Baixo Alentejo essentially linked to the agro-industrial sectors, agri-food and water.
